Orange Juice Cake

This easy Orange Juice Cake is incredibly moist and bursting with citrus flavor, perfect for any occasion. It features a tender crumb and a sweet orange glaze.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 40 minutes
Total Time 1 hour
Servings: 10 slices
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

Cake
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1.5 cups granulated sugar
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 3 large eggs
  • 0.5 cup vegetable oil
  • 1 cup orange juice freshly squeezed
  • 1 tablespoon orange zest
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Orange Glaze
  • 1.5 cups powdered sugar
  • 3-4 tablespoons orange juice freshly squeezed

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Mixing bowls
  • Whisk
  • Measuring cups and spoons
  • 9x13 inch Baking Pan or Bundt Pan

Method
 

Baking the Cake
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ease and flour a 9x13 inch baking pan or a bundt pan.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t until well combined.
  3. In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, vegetable oil, orange juice, orange zest, and vanilla extract.
  4.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ix until just combined, being careful not to overmix.
  5.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for 35-45 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Making the Glaze
  1. While the cake cools slightly, whisk together the powdered sugar and orange juice in a small bowl until smooth.
  2. Drizzle the glaze over the warm cake and let it set before serving.

Notes

For an extra citrus kick, soak the baked cake with a simple syrup made from equal parts sugar and orange juice before applying the glaze.
